Many of these software projects are hosted on Github, under a GNU General Public License, version 3.
Spectral analysis of time series
- An R package to carry out the spectral analysis of time series. Now includes many spectral-based tests of periodicity (with L. Wei).
Wavelet methods for time series
Simulation methods for time series
- Simulation of stationary Gaussian time series using the Davies-Harte algorithm
- Approximate simulation of stationary Gaussian time series using the Gaussian Spectral Synthesis Method (GSSM)
Other time series methods
- Various functions useful for the analysis of time series in R
- R functions to detrend response time (RT) sequences (with M. Peruggia and T. Van Zandt)
Spatial modeling
Distributions
- An R package with functions for univariate truncated normal distributions (with C. Hans)
- R functions involving the noncentral F distribution (with L. Wei)
